
WWE Raw: Live Results, Reaction and Analysis for November 9
Welcome to Bleacher Report's live WWE Raw coverage for November 9.
According to James Wortman of WWE.com, the tournament to crown a new WWE world heavyweight champion will begin during Monday's show in Manchester, England.
Nobody is happy that Seth Rollins suffered an injury, but this opens up the door for WWE to do something unexpected. Hopefully management sees the unique opportunity this is and takes a chance by pushing someone new.

We can also expect to see more developments in all the big storylines heading into Survivor Series. No traditional elimination matches have been booked yet, so that will likely be a priority.
Who will fight for a chance at the WWE World Heavyweight Championship?
Has Paige bitten off more than she can chew with Charlotte and Becky Lynch?
Will Kane or The Undertaker return to seek revenge on The Wyatt Family?
Does Roman Reigns have to fight in the tournament after already having earned a title shot?
And lastly, will WWE feature more of its British stars to play to the audience?
